Introduction to common data types in Oracle database
Oracle database is a commonly used relational database management system that supports multiple data types to meet different needs. When using Oracle database, it is very important to understand the data types of the database. This article will introduce the commonly used data types in Oracle database, with specific code examples.
1. Numerical data type
- NUMBER
NUMBER is the most commonly used numerical data type in Oracle database, used to store integers or floats. Points. The NUMBER data type can specify precision and range.
CREATE TABLE employees ( employee_id NUMBER(5), salary NUMBER(10, 2) );
- INTEGER
INTEGER is used to store integer values, ranging from -2^31 to 2^31-1.
CREATE TABLE students ( student_id INTEGER );
2. Character data type
- CHAR
CHAR is used to store fixed-length strings, with a maximum length of 2000 characters.
CREATE TABLE customers ( customer_id CHAR(10), customer_name CHAR(50) );
- VARCHAR2
VARCHAR2 is used to store variable-length strings with a maximum length of 4000 characters.
CREATE TABLE products ( product_id VARCHAR2(20), product_name VARCHAR2(100) );
3. Date data type
- DATE
DATE is used to store date and time information.
CREATE TABLE orders ( order_id NUMBER, order_date DATE );
- TIMESTAMP
TIMESTAMP is used to store date and timestamp information.
CREATE TABLE logs ( log_id NUMBER, log_time TIMESTAMP );
4. LOB data type
LOB (Large Object) data type is used to store large amounts of text data, binary data or image data.
CREATE TABLE documents ( document_id NUMBER, content CLOB );

Creating an Oracle table involves the following steps: Use the CREATE TABLE syntax to specify table names, column names, data types, constraints, and default values. The table name should be concise and descriptive, and should not exceed 30 characters. The column name should be descriptive, and the data type specifies the data type stored in the column. The NOT NULL constraint ensures that null values are not allowed in the column, and the DEFAULT clause specifies the default values for the column. PRIMARY KEY Constraints to identify the unique record of the table. FOREIGN KEY constraint specifies that the column in the table refers to the primary key in another table. Oracle provides multiple deduplication query methods: The DISTINCT keyword returns a unique value for each column. The GROUP BY clause groups the results and returns a non-repetitive value for each group. The UNIQUE keyword is used to create an index containing only unique rows, and querying the index will automatically deduplicate. The ROW_NUMBER() function assigns unique numbers and filters out results that contain only line 1. The MIN() or MAX() function returns non-repetitive values of a numeric column. The INTERSECT operator returns the common values of the two result sets (no duplicates).
